54% of users choose counselor by proximity. It is therefore important to know whether 20 Ormerod St
SA South Australia 5271
Australia is close to our area.
66 Smith St
Naracoorte South Australia 5271
Australia
54% of users choose counselor by proximity. It is therefore important to know whether 66 Smith St
Naracoorte South Australia 5271
Australia is close to our area.